What Is Codeine 30mg?

Codeine is an opioid derived from the opium poppy plant. It is considered a “prodrug,” meaning it is converted into morphine in the body, which then produces its pain-relieving effects.

At a 30mg dose, codeine is typically used for short-term pain relief when other non-opioid medications are not sufficient. It is sometimes combined with other pain relievers like acetaminophen to improve effectiveness.

Medical Uses of Codeine

Doctors may prescribe Codeine 30mg for several conditions, including:

  • Mild to moderate pain management
  • Post-surgical pain relief (short term)
  • Injury-related pain
  • Persistent cough (in specific medical cases)
  • Pain that does not respond to standard analgesics

Codeine is generally not recommended for long-term pain management due to the risk of dependence and tolerance.

How Codeine Works in the Body

Codeine works by binding to opioid receptors in the brain and spinal cord. Once metabolized into morphine, it alters how pain signals are processed and perceived.

This leads to:

  • Reduced pain sensation
  • A calming effect on the nervous system
  • Relief from discomfort
  • Mild sedation in some individuals

However, the strength of its effect can vary depending on individual metabolism and sensitivity.

Effects of Codeine 30mg

The effects of codeine may vary from person to person, but commonly include:

Therapeutic Effects

  • Pain relief
  • Reduced coughing reflex
  • Relaxation
  • Improved comfort during recovery

Common Side Effects

  • Drowsiness
  • Dizziness
  • Nausea or vomiting
  • Constipation
  • Dry mouth
  • Mild confusion

Serious Side Effects

In some cases, more severe reactions may occur:

  • Difficulty breathing
  • Severe drowsiness or sedation
  • Allergic reactions
  • Low blood pressure
  • Risk of dependence or misuse

Immediate medical attention is required if severe symptoms appear.

Important Safety Information

Codeine is a controlled medication due to its potential for misuse and dependence. It must be taken exactly as prescribed.

Key safety precautions include:

  • Do not consume alcohol while taking codeine
  • Avoid combining with sedatives unless directed by a doctor
  • Do not drive or operate machinery after taking it
  • Do not increase dosage without medical approval
  • Do not share medication with others

Patients should always inform their doctor about existing medical conditions and other medications they are using.

Risk of Dependence and Tolerance

One of the most important concerns with codeine is the potential for dependence. Regular use may lead to tolerance, where higher doses are required to achieve the same effect.

Stopping suddenly after prolonged use may lead to withdrawal symptoms such as:

  • Irritability
  • Sweating
  • Restlessness
  • Muscle pain
  • Anxiety

This is why medical supervision is essential when adjusting or stopping the medication.

Who Should Avoid Codeine?

Codeine may not be suitable for everyone. It should be avoided or used with extreme caution in individuals who:

  • Have respiratory disorders such as asthma or COPD
  • Have a history of substance abuse
  • Are pregnant or breastfeeding (unless medically advised)
  • Are taking other central nervous system depressants
  • Have certain liver or kidney conditions

A healthcare provider must evaluate risks before prescribing.

Storage and Handling

Proper storage of codeine is important for safety:

  • Store at room temperature
  • Keep away from moisture and heat
  • Keep out of reach of children
  • Use only as prescribed
  • Dispose of unused medication safely
